Schema App’s Drupal Module has the ability to cache schema markup locally, pulling schema markup from Schema App’s Schema Markup Delivery Network.
Resources Required
Instructions
Create a step-by-step guide
Step 1: Download Schema App's Drupal Module
- Log into your Schema App account. Click the dropdown on your selected project and confirm that:
1. You've added a website URL
2. The deployment type has been set to Drupal
From the menu on the left, navigate to Deployment > Integrations
Copy the Account ID and save it to your clipboard. You'll need this information soon.
Step 2: Download Schema App's Drupal Module
- In a new tab, navigate to Schema App's module is available through Drupal at https://www.drupal.org/project/schemaapp
Step 3: Install Schema App's Drupal Module
- Install the module following the steps described in Drupal's Installing Modules documentation.
- After installing
- Under Configuration -> System choose “Schema App module settings”
- Enter your Account ID which can be found in the Schema App web application. Click 'Integrations' on the side menu.
Copy the Account ID.
Paste Account ID in field provided. - Optionally configure the frequency with checking the CDN for new content (in seconds), the default is once every 24 hours.
- Optionally check “Use get parameters” if your Drupal configuration uses parameters over paths in its URL scheme i.e. https://example.com/posts?q=1234 as opposed to https://example.com/posts/october-update (in most cases this will be unchecked).
If you are not deploying markup from the Schema App Highlighter, click 'Save Configuration'. No further action is required. This also applies to Crawler deployments.
If you are using Highlighter Markup and JavaScript, continue with step e and f - If you are deploying markup from the Shema App Highlighter markup check "Enable Highlighter JavaScript Markup". This will include the highligter.js scripts in the web page.
Then click 'Save'.Note: If you are checking this for the first time on an existing installation, you may need to clear Drupal's cache.
- Under Configuration -> System choose “Schema App module settings”
No further action is required.
Your plugin is now activated and will deploy markup to all URLs that you have created markup for in Schema App.
Support
For support with your Drupal module setup or to get your Account Id, contact your Customer Success Manager or support@schemaapp.com.
Was this article helpful?
That’s Great!
Thank you for your feedback
Sorry! We couldn't be helpful
Thank you for your feedback
Feedback sent
We appreciate your effort and will try to fix the article